When it comes to facilities, Llanfairpwll Station offers the essentials. Be aware there isn't a ticket office on-site nor machines for purchasing and collecting tickets, which makes it crucial for passengers to plan ahead. You can make use of online services for ticket booking. While smartcard facilities aren't available here, an induction loop is present for enhanced accessibility for those with impaired hearing.
Though the station lacks a waiting room, passengers can find seating available. Accessibility comes with its own set of challenges, as step-free access varies across platforms. Platform 1, for instance, can be accessed without steps by a gate from the car park. Meanwhile, access to Platform 2 involves the use of a footbridge or an unpaved path, which might be tricky for those with mobility issues. Facilities like toilets, baby changing, and Wi-Fi are not available, urging visitors to make appropriate preparations.
Despite the modest amenities, Llanfairpwll Station is well-connected by other transport links. For onward travel, buses are conveniently accessible from the main road in the village's center. If you require a rail replacement service, these buses also stop along Holyhead Road, ensuring continuity of service. However, be advised that while cycling storage is available, bicycle hire isn’t on offer at this location.

Northampton station is well-equipped with essential fac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office operates from 06:00 to 19: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, while extending its hours on Sundays from 07:00 to 20:00. Ticket machines and smartcard validators are accessible, making it convenient for passengers to purchase or collect their tickets.
For those requiring assistance, help is readily available at multiple points, and the station provides useful resources such as departure screens and announcements. Although there is no luggage storage, the station is under the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ment with CCTV coverage.
Additional amenities enhance your travel comfort—refresh with a drink from Soho Piccolo Coffee Shop or a quick read at WHSmith. Although there is no public Wi-Fi or payphones available, the station surrounds promise connectivity options for modern travelers.
Northampton train station prides itself on accessibility, providing step-free access throughout and ticket barriers. All platforms are accessible, making it exceptionally convenient for those with reduced mobility. The provision of ramps, accessible toilets, and staff assistance ensures a comfortable journey for every passenger.
Car park facilities, operated by SABA UK, are open 24/7 with a capacity of 866 spaces including 12 accessible spaces. Payment for parking includes various methods like the Saba Parking UK app, a convenient option for anyone driving to the station.
The seamless transition from train travel to other transport modes is a vital feature of Northampton station. Rail replacement services operate from the car park side of the station, ensuring minimal disruption during planned maintenance or unexpected rail service changes. Taxis are easily accessible from the front of the station, and local bus information is available, making planning onward journeys straightforward.
For those inclined to take a green approach, bicycle storage is available with 85 spaces in sheltered stands, monitored by CCTV. Although bike hire facilities are not present, this provision encourages eco-friendly travel within Northampton.
